Analysis
The most recent figure for reserve assets, reserve position in the imf, adjusted using imf in Eswatini is 0.0017 US dollar per US$ of GDP, measured in 2025.
That represents a change of down 1.1% on the previous year and down 25.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, reserve assets, reserve position in the imf, adjusted using imf in Eswatini peaked at 0.0087 US dollar per US$ of GDP in 1981 and was at its lowest, 0 US dollar per US$ of GDP, in 1989.
Eswatini ranks 67th of 163 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Reserve assets, Reserve position in the IMF, Adjusted using IMF accounting records (Assets, Positions, US dollar) div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Reserve assets, Reserve position in the IMF, Adjusted using IMF accounting records (Assets, Positions, US dollar) ÷ GDP (current US$)
